在当今网络环境中,Clash作为一个强大的代理工具,受到了越来越多用户的青睐。本文将深入探讨如何在Clash中进行转规则的操作,以帮助用户有效优化网络体验。
什么是Clash?
Clash是一款基于规则的代理工具,它利用SS/SSR/V2Ray等多种协议,为用户提供网络访问服务。通过灵活的规则配置,Clash可以自动选择最佳的代理服务,确保用户的网络连接稳定且快速。
Clash的基本组成部分
在学习如何转规则之前,了解Clash的基本组成部分非常重要。Clash的配置通常包含以下几个部分:
- 代理服务器:支持多种协议的代理节点。
- 规则:定义流量走向的依据。
- 配置文件:包含用户的所有设置。
如何获取Clash的配置文件
要开始使用Clash,你需要获取一个有效的配置文件。一般来说,配置文件可以通过以下方式获取:
- 访问第三方提供的订阅地址。
- 自己手动编写配置文件。
- 从社区获取共享配置。
Clash的转规则概述
什么是转规则?
转规则是指在Clash中如何根据特定条件选择不同的代理策略。它允许用户根据实际需求,灵活应对不同的网络环境。
转规则的意义
- 灵活性:根据不同的网络条件调整策略。
- 优化连接:减少延迟,提升访问速度。
- 安全性:通过多种协议保障个人信息安全。
如何在Clash中转规则
步骤一:打开配置文件
在Clash的主界面,找到配置文件的路径,通常为config.yaml
。使用文本编辑器打开此文件。
步骤二:添加或修改规则
在配置文件中,找到rules
部分,进行如下操作:
- 添加规则:按照语法格式添加新的规则。
- 修改现有规则:调整已有规则的优先级和条件。
示例规则
yaml rules:
- DOMAIN-SUFFIX,google.com,Proxy
- GEOIP,CN,DIRECT
- MATCH,Proxy
上述规则的含义是:对Google域名的请求走代理,而中国的IP地址则直接访问。
步骤三:保存并重启Clash
在完成配置后,保存文件并重启Clash,以使更改生效。
规则种类与策略
基于域名的规则
- DOMAIN:针对特定的域名。
- DOMAIN-SUFFIX:针对特定后缀的域名。
基于IP的规则
- GEOIP:根据IP地址的地理位置进行匹配。
- IP-CIDR:根据特定的IP段进行访问。
其他类型的规则
- MATCH:默认规则,用于未匹配到的流量。
常见问题解答(FAQ)
Clash支持哪些代理协议?
Clash支持多种代理协议,包括但不限于:
- Shadowsocks(SS)
- ShadowsocksR(SSR)
- V2Ray
这些协议旨在提供不同的安全性和速度体验。
Clash的规则是如何生效的?
Clash根据配置文件中的rules
部分,按顺序逐条检查规则,一旦匹配到流量,就会采取相应的策略。
如何使用Clash的图形界面?
Clash的图形界面通常有多个功能模块,可以帮助用户更方便地调整配置。用户可以通过简洁的界面管理节点、规则和日志等内容。
Clash是否支持多种平台?
是的,Clash可以在多个平台上使用,包括Windows、macOS和Linux等。用户只需下载相应的版本进行安装即可。
修改规则后,Clash需要重启吗?
是的,在修改配置文件后,为了使新规则生效,用户需要重启Clash。通过这种方式,Clash会重新加载配置文件,并应用最新的规则。
结语
通过本文的介绍,您应该对Clash的转规则有了更深入的理解。合理设置和使用转规则,可以显著提高用户的网络体验。如果您还有其他问题,欢迎在评论区留言,我们将尽快为您解答。